ARP Head Studs & Engine Fasteners
ARP head studs replace factory head bolts with precision-machined threaded studs that provide more consistent and repeatable clamping force on the cylinder head gasket. Unlike head bolts that apply torque through both rotational and tensile forces, head studs allow the nut to be torqued concentrically on a stud that is already stationary, producing more even clamping load across the entire head gasket surface.
Popular ARP Head Stud Applications
ARP head studs are available for a wide range of performance and turbocharged engines including the Subaru EJ series, Honda K series and B series, Mitsubishi 4G63 and 4B11, Honda Civic and Integra, Toyota 2JZ-GTE, Nissan SR20DET and RB series, GM LS series, Ford Coyote and 5.0, and Dodge/Chrysler HEMI applications. ARP offers both 8740 chromoly and ARP2000 alloy head stud kits, with the ARP2000 material providing approximately 20 percent higher tensile strength for high-boost applications above 30 psi.
Why are head studs preferred over head bolts on boosted engines?
Head studs are preferred on turbocharged and supercharged engines because higher combustion pressures place greater stress on the head-to-block joint, requiring higher clamping force to prevent head gasket lift and combustion gas leakage. ARP head studs allow precise torque value targeting during installation using the included ARP Ultra-Torque lubricant, which eliminates friction variation between torque applications and ensures every stud is loaded to the same clamping force. This consistency is particularly important on engines that require multiple heat cycles and retorquing during initial break-in.
Do head studs require machining or special installation procedures?
ARP head stud installation requires installing the studs hand-tight or with a stud driver into clean, dry threaded holes in the block. The use of ARP Ultra-Torque lubricant on the threads and under the nuts is required for accurate torque readings. Some applications with interference-fit stud holes require applying thread sealer to the lower stud thread if the holes are open to the water jacket. ARP includes application-specific torque specifications and installation instructions with every head stud kit.
